Output d7575581304cd6b4562f3272f318dca29e85dc22e4262d05f8821b66c82464a6:14

value
432926
script pubkey
OP_0 OP_PUSHBYTES_20 ec2f949239043be294dcf6b22ba05dcce0720e3e
address
bc1qashefy3eqsa799xu76ezhgzaens8yr37n28qxh
transaction
d7575581304cd6b4562f3272f318dca29e85dc22e4262d05f8821b66c82464a6
spent
true